#6f2f8f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6f2f8f is composed of 43.5% red, 18.4%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.4% cyan, 67.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 280 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 37.3%. #6f2f8f color hex could be obtained by blending #de5eff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#6f2f8f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6f2f8f has RGB values of R:111, G:47,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 7286671.

Shades and Tints of #6f2f8f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08030a is the darkest color, while #fcf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f2f8f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605b63 is the less saturated color, while #7e03bb is the most saturated one.
